--- Comment #25 from Katrin Fischer <[email protected]> --- Hi Joy, sorry, I missed getting back to this :( (In reply to Joy Nelson from comment #24) > Katrin, > Currently this analytic feature only works where the leader7=s. I'd like to > propose the following changes to this feature to allow it be used by your > library and others in a more standard method. > > 1. Allow the link to appear when leader7 =s or leader7=m. Both monographs > and serial records can have component parts and as such have children that > should be displayed by this feature. The Show analytics link is searching > for bib-level:a (Monographic component part) and bib-level:b (Serial > component part). Yes, that makes sense. Actually we have that link in some custom XSLT, but use a different class to allow changing visibility independently for m and s. > > 2. Add a search function to this display page that checks the index > (Host-item) to see if any children are present. If so, then display the > "Show Analytics Link". This search would search for control number or title > depending on the value of usecontrolnumber sys pref. I would be totally ok with that. I just never figured out how to do this myself. Some help here would be great. I am not sure Host-item will work as an index or if a new index for $w in 773 would be needed for the controlnumber part. > 3. Add a syspref for this method of analytic cataloging, much like we have > for Easy Analytics and 'use control number'. Allow libraries the ability to > turn off the analytic cataloging if they don't use it. Call it > "ShowLinktoChildfromParent"? I am not sure about adding more and more prefs when CSS would work, but if we add the function in 2) it makes sense to have a real switch to avoid unnecessary processing.
